This print showcases the Amulet of Bastet, a remarkable artifact dating back to c. 1069-715 BC in ancient Egypt. Crafted from hematite, this small amulet measures 4.4x1.1x2.8 cm and is currently housed at the Cleveland Museum of Art in Ohio, USA. The Amulet of Bastet holds great significance as it represents the goddess Bastet, also known as Baast or Baset, who was revered as a deity associated with protection and fertility. Depicted here in her feline form, she embodies grace and power. With its intricate details and rich history, this amulet transports us back to the Third Intermediate Period of ancient Egypt when it was created.
